Project Description
Using data visualization to close the gap of accessibility in the growing field of study of the Digital Humanities.
In occasion of the 500 year anniversary of Leonardo DaVinci’s death in 2019, The Visual Agency in close collaboration with the Veneranda Biblioteca Ambrosiana, a renowned Museum in Milan has conceptualised, designed and developed an innovative data-visualisation instrument that enables the general public to independently elaborate on and discover the Codex Atlanticus, one of Leonardo DaVinci’s greatest masterpieces without boundaries and in away that has never been possible before.
This self-initiated bilingual project (Italian and English) www.codex-atlanticus.it is offering a panoramic overview of the Codex Atlanticus combined with drill-down and analytical functions to explore this epic work in more detail. Rearranging and filtering the pages of the Codex uncovers insights into Leonardo Da Vinci’s life, enabling all users to explore his thought evolution throughout his life.
